So I got that education for free.
I educated myself.
And I fell in love with literature, and I believe that literature really, really mattered.
And literature saved my life, and literature could save the world.
And I believe we all should find that passion, whatever it is, for each of us.
But I had to understand something, which is that if stories have the power to save us,
They have the power to destroy us as well.
If you give something that much power, that's simply the recognition that you're granting it.
How did I know that?
One day when I was 11 or 12 years old, I put this movie into the VCR.
It was called Apocalypse Now.
I'd never seen any Vietnam War story before.
I was a war fanatic.
I loved American war movies.
I was an American.
Started watching this movie.
And I realized the Vietnamese are the bad guys in here.
Or if we're not the bad guys, we're the unimportant people.
The Americans are the good guys.
Or the Americans are the good guys even if they're the bad guys.
